Visual Studio Code is a free, open-source code editor developed by Microsoft. Boasts the world's largest ecosystem of plugins, language servers, and debuggers. Cursor

The AI-first Code Editor built for pairing with frontier LLMs

Cursor is a fork of VS Code engineered from the ground up for deep AI integration. Features whole-repository indexing, multi-file edits (Composer), and instant tab-completion.

Windsurf

The first agentic IDE by Codeium with cascade collaboration

Windsurf by Codeium introduces Cascade, an agentic AI system that understands full developer intent, tracks contextual history, and acts as a genuine pair programmer.
